Mr Kenneth Chan was born in Hong Kong and grew up in Auckland where he obtained his medical degree. He has worked in the Wellington/Hutt region since 2005 and has returned to New Zealand after finishing his fellowship training in the United Kingdom in 2013.
Kenneth is able to conduct his consultation in Cantonese and Mandarin if required.
Kenneths Private Surgery is carried out at Southern Cross Wellington, Bowen Hospital and Boulcoutt Hospital.
He has a Licentiate Diploma in piano performance and can frequently be seen attending local classical concerts. He is also keen on chasing fresh powder on the ski slopes when opportunity beckons!
Specialist Training:
Kenneth’s vocational training in Ophthalmology took place in Wellington and Christchurch.
Kenneth did his fellowship training in Oculoplastic and Orbital Surgery in Newcastle upon Tyne, United Kingdom.
Oculoplastic conditions including eyelid malposition, ptosis and dermatochalasis, periocular skin tumours, dry/watery eyes, thyroid eye disease, orbital disorders and socket reconstruction.
